  • Sketch by J. Andre Smith, 1918, The Road to Essey

    Object Details

    artist

    Smith, J. Andre

    Description

    Charcoal sketch on white paper. Sketch shows groups of American soldiers marching off into the distance between army motor trucks on a dirt road. The road is surrounded by large dead trees and barbed wire entanglements on either side. Rolling hills and fields in the distance. The sky is very cloudy and dark with observation balloons floating in the distance.
